Find the probability of rolling a prime number when a 16-sided die is rolled.

A) 5/16
B) 3/8
C) 7/16
D) 1/16

Explanation:

If the given dice is 16-sided, then it would contain following numbers:-

1,2,3,4,5,6,7,8,9,10,11,12,13,14,15,16

We know that, the numbers which aren't divisible by any numbers except itself and 1 are prime numbers.

Out of 1,2,3,4,5,6,7,8,9,10,11,12,13,14,15,16

the prime numbers are as follow:-

2,3,5,7,11,13

Here, the number of prime numbers are 6,

Therefore, the probability of rolling a prime number when the dice is rolled is

  • 6/16=3/8

Hence, option B. is the correct answer.
